Exploring the Technology Behind Modern Slot Machines

Modern slot machines represent a fascinating confluence of technology and entertainment, revolutionizing the casino experience. Gone are the days of purely mechanical reels; today’s slots incorporate advanced software algorithms, random number generators (RNGs), and sophisticated graphics to create a highly immersive gaming environment. Understanding the technology behind these machines is essential for anyone interested in the future of casino gaming.

At the core of every modern slot machine lies its RNG, a complex algorithm that ensures each spin is independent and completely random. This technology guarantees fairness, making it impossible to predict or manipulate outcomes. Additionally, contemporary slot machines utilize computer programming to manage paylines, bonus rounds, and animations, creating engaging user interfaces that attract players worldwide. The integration of network connectivity allows real-time data collection and remote updates, enhancing player experiences and operational efficiency.
